Why Attending To Financial Health Is Key to Labor Force Stability
The American Psychological Association (APA) has actually continually reported that monetary concerns are one of the top sources of tension for adults in the united state Over 70% of participants in a recent APA study specified that money problems are a substantial stress factor in their lives. This tension has straight effects for office performance: staff members distracted by personal economic issues are more probable to experience fatigue, miss out on target dates, and seek out brand-new work chances with greater salaries to cover their financial debts.
Financially stressed out workers are additionally much more vulnerable to health problems, such as stress and anxiety, depression, and hypertension, which contribute to enhanced medical care prices for companies.
